Govee vs. Philips Hue: A Comprehensive Comparison of Smart Lighting Systems

Smart lighting has become an integral part of modern homes, offering convenience, energy efficiency, and the ability to create personalized atmospheres. Among the most popular brands in the smart lighting market are Govee and Philips Hue. Both offer a wide range of products, from smart bulbs to light strips, and cater to different consumer needs. But which one is better? In this article, we’ll dive deep into the features, performance, pricing, and overall value of Govee and Philips Hue to help you decide which smart lighting system is right for you.


1. Overview of Govee and Philips Hue

Govee

Govee is a relatively newer player in the smart lighting industry, known for its affordable and feature-rich products. The brand has gained popularity for its RGBIC light strips, smart bulbs, and innovative lighting solutions that often include app control, voice assistant compatibility, and unique features like music sync and scene customization. Govee’s products are designed to be accessible to a wide audience, making them a great choice for budget-conscious consumers.

Philips Hue

Philips Hue, on the other hand, is a pioneer in the smart lighting space. Launched in 2012, it has established itself as a premium brand with a reputation for high-quality products, seamless integration with smart home ecosystems, and a robust ecosystem of accessories. Philips Hue offers a wide range of products, including smart bulbs, light strips, lamps, and even outdoor lighting. Its products are known for their reliability, color accuracy, and compatibility with major smart home platforms like Apple HomeKit, Google Assistant, and Amazon Alexa.


2. Product Range and Features

Govee

Govee’s product lineup is extensive and includes:

  • RGBIC Light Strips: Known for their vibrant colors and ability to display multiple colors simultaneously.
  • Smart Bulbs: Affordable options with adjustable brightness and color temperature.
  • Desk Lamps and Floor Lamps: Stylish designs with customizable lighting effects.
  • Outdoor Lighting: Weather-resistant options for patios and gardens.
  • Accessories: Light bars, neon ropes, and gaming-specific lighting.

Govee’s standout features include:

  • Music Sync: Lights that react to sound, perfect for parties or gaming setups.
  • Scene Modes: Pre-set lighting scenes for different moods and activities.
  • DIY Mode: Allows users to create custom lighting effects.
  • App Control: Intuitive app with scheduling, grouping, and remote control options.

Philips Hue

Philips Hue offers a more refined and premium product range, including:

  • Smart Bulbs: Available in white, white ambiance, and full-color options.
  • Light Strips: Flexible and adhesive strips with excellent color accuracy.
  • Indoor and Outdoor Lighting: Lamps, spotlights, and pathway lights.
  • Hue Bridge: A central hub for controlling up to 50 lights.
  • Accessories: Motion sensors, dimmer switches, and smart plugs.

Philips Hue’s standout features include:

  • Color Accuracy: Industry-leading color reproduction and brightness.
  • Ecosystem Integration: Works seamlessly with Apple HomeKit, Google Assistant, and Amazon Alexa.
  • Routines and Automation: Advanced scheduling and automation options.
  • Hue Sync: Syncs lights with movies, games, and music for an immersive experience.

3. Performance and Quality

Govee

Govee’s products are known for their affordability and versatility. However, they may not match Philips Hue in terms of build quality and color accuracy. Govee’s RGBIC light strips, for example, offer vibrant colors and unique effects, but the colors can sometimes appear less natural compared to Hue. The app experience is user-friendly, but occasional connectivity issues have been reported.

Philips Hue

Philips Hue is renowned for its high-quality construction and consistent performance. The color accuracy and brightness of Hue bulbs are unmatched, making them ideal for creating precise lighting atmospheres. The Hue Bridge ensures reliable connectivity, and the ecosystem’s stability is a major selling point. However, this premium quality comes at a higher price.


4. Pricing and Value

Govee

Govee’s biggest advantage is its affordability. A basic RGB light strip from Govee can cost around $30, while a full-color smart bulb is priced at approximately $20. This makes Govee an excellent choice for those on a budget or looking to experiment with smart lighting without a significant investment.

Philips Hue

Philips Hue is significantly more expensive. A single full-color smart bulb can cost around $50, and a starter kit with a bridge and multiple bulbs can set you back $200 or more. While the price is steep, the premium quality, reliability, and ecosystem integration justify the cost for many users.


5. Ease of Use and Compatibility

Govee

Govee’s app is intuitive and easy to navigate, making it simple for beginners to set up and control their lights. The products are compatible with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ant, but integration with Apple HomeKit is limited. Govee’s DIY mode and scene customization options add a layer of creativity for users.

Philips Hue

Philips Hue’s app is polished and offers advanced features like geofencing, routines, and third-party app integration. The Hue Bridge enhances the system’s reliability and allows for seamless control of multiple lights. Philips Hue’s compatibility with Apple HomeKit, Google Assistant, and Amazon Alexa makes it a versatile choice for smart home enthusiasts.


6. Innovation and Unique Features

Govee

Govee stands out with its innovative features like music sync, DIY mode, and RGBIC technology, which allows for multiple colors on a single light strip. The brand also offers gaming-specific lighting products that sync with gameplay, adding an immersive element to gaming setups.

Philips Hue

Philips Hue excels in ecosystem integration and advanced automation. Features like Hue Sync and the ability to create dynamic lighting scenes based on time of day or activity set it apart. The brand’s commitment to quality and consistency ensures a premium experience.


7. Customer Support and Warranty

Govee

Govee offers decent customer support and a standard warranty for its products. However, some users have reported delays in response times and limited support options.

Philips Hue

Philips Hue provides excellent customer support and a two-year warranty for its products. The brand’s reputation for reliability and quality extends to its after-sales service.


8. Which One Should You Choose?

Choose Govee If:

  • You’re on a budget and want affordable smart lighting options.
  • You’re looking for creative lighting effects like music sync and DIY modes.
  • You don’t need advanced ecosystem integration or Apple HomeKit compatibility.

Choose Philips Hue If:

  • You’re willing to invest in a premium smart lighting system.
  • You prioritize color accuracy, reliability, and seamless integration with smart home ecosystems.
  • You want advanced automation and customization options.

9. Final Verdict

Both Govee and Philips Hue have their strengths and cater to different audiences. Govee is an excellent choice for budget-conscious consumers who want creative and versatile lighting options. On the other hand, Philips Hue is the go-to brand for those seeking a premium, reliable, and feature-rich smart lighting system.

Ultimately, the decision comes down to your budget, needs, and preferences. If you’re just starting with smart lighting or want to experiment without breaking the bank, Govee is a fantastic option. However, if you’re building a comprehensive smart home ecosystem and value quality and reliability, Philips Hue is worth the investment.
